There are many reasons to consider refinancing. Saving money is obvious. In August 2008, the average 30-year mortgage rate was 6.48%. After the financial crisis, rates for the same type of loan continued to decline. As of December 2012, the 30-year mortgage rate had halved over the past four years to 3.35%.

Understanding A Cash Out Refinance

The average annual rate for 2017 has increased to 3.99%. According to Freddie Mac, it rose to 4.54% in 2018, then fell to 3.94% for 2019, before falling further in 2020 with an annual average of 3.11%.

Loans come with strict conditions. If you want to exchange some of your home equity for cash, it will cost you — how much depends on your home equity, as well as your credit score. .

For example, if your FICO score is 700, your loan-to-value ratio is 76%, and the loan is considered a cash-out, the lender will add 0.750 points to the higher cost of the loan. If the loan amount is $200,000, the lender will add $1,500 to that amount (although each lender is different). Alternatively, you can pay a higher interest rate – from 0.125% to 0.250%, depending on the market.

However, in some cases, there may be no strictness for loan repayment. A high credit score and low loan-to-value ratio can tip the numbers in your favor. If you have a credit score of 750 and a credit-to-value ratio of less than 60%, for example, you won’t be charged extra for the loan. Because the lender believes that you are less likely to default on the loan than by making a refi rate and schedule.

Even if you don’t get paid, your loan will be a reverse loan. If you pay off a credit card, car loan, or anything else that isn’t part of your mortgage, the lender usually considers it a cash loan. If you’re consolidating two mortgages into one – and one is a first loan – the new loan will also be classified as cash.
